Matthew Liberatore gets the nod on the mound for the St. Louis Cardinals against Jorge Soler and the Miami Marlins on Wednesday at 6:40 PM ET. The Marlins have been listed as -114 moneyline favorites for this matchup against the Cardinals (-106). Miami (-1.5) is favored on the run line. The over/under is 9 runs for the matchup.

The scheduled starters are Bryan Hoeing (1-2) for the Miami Marlins, and Liberatore (1-3) for the St. Louis Cardinals.

Marlins vs. Cardinals Betting Insights

  • This season, the Marlins have been favored 41 times and won 27, or 65.9%, of those games.
  • Miami has a record of 26-11 in games when oddsmakers favor them by at least -114 on the moneyline.
  • The oddsmakers' moneyline implies a 53.3% chance of a victory for the Marlins.
  • The Cardinals have won in 14, or 38.9%, of the 36 contests they have been named as odds-on underdogs this year.
  • St. Louis has a mark of 13-19 in contests where bookmakers favor it by -106 or worse on the moneyline.
  • The Cardinals have an implied victory probability of 51.5% according to the moneyline set for this matchup.

Marlins Recent Betting Performance

  • The Marlins won each of the five games they played as a moneyline favorite over their last 10 matchups.
  • In their last 10 outings (all 10 of them had set totals), the Marlins and their opponents combined to go over the run total five times.
  • The Marlins have gone 5-5-0 against the spread over their past 10 games.

Marlins Player Insights

  • The Marlins best hitter so far this season is Luis Arraez, who's hitting at a team-leading .387 rate along with three homers and 41 RBI.
  • In all of the majors, Arraez ranks 283rd in home runs and 71st in RBI.
  • Arraez brings a hitting streak of five games into this game. In his last five games he is batting .316 with a double, two walks and two RBI.
  • Jorge Soler has shown off his power as he paces his team with 22 home runs and 49 runs batted in.
  • Soler is sixth in home runs and 33rd in RBI among all MLB hitters this year.
  • Soler has two games in a row with at least one hit. In his last five games he is batting .316 with four doubles, a home run, two walks and three RBI.
  • Bryan De La Cruz is hitting .271 with 17 doubles, nine home runs and 23 walks.
  • Yuli Gurriel has nine doubles, three triples, three home runs and 15 walks while batting .271.

Cardinals Recent Betting Performance

  • In six games as underdogs over the last 10 matchups, the Cardinals have a record of 2-4.
  • In their last 10 games with a total, the Cardinals and their opponents have combined to hit the over five times.
  • The Cardinals have five wins against the spread in their last 10 chances.

Cardinals Player Insights

  • Paul Goldschmidt paces the Cardinals with a team-high batting average of .288.
  • Among all batters in MLB, Goldschmidt's home run total is 29th and his RBI tally is 47th.
  • Nolan Arenado has hit 16 home runs with 55 runs batted in, leading the team in both categories.
  • Arenado is 24th among all hitters in MLB in home runs, and 15th in RBI.
  • Tommy Edman has 15 doubles, three triples, seven home runs and 24 walks while batting .237.
  • Brendan Donovan is batting .282 with seven doubles, nine home runs and 30 walks.
